North Central Mental Health Services, Inc. is a broad-based community mental health and substance use, addiction and recovery provider serving residents within Franklin County, Ohio.

North Central serves all age groups to provide treatment for children, adults, couples and families.  We provide assistance to deal with life problems and pressures in positive, constructive ways.  Our outpatient programs provide counseling and therapy to help deal with situational issues as well as therapy for those struggling with long-term, intense mental disabilities. 

North Central’s substance use disorder, addiction and recovery services provide the support, treatment and encouragement needed to help individuals move toward recovery and independence.  Our residential program assists individuals suffering from mental illness who are currently unable to live unassisted but strive to become independent and self-supporting.

In addition to direct treatment and residential programs, North Central emphasizes the importance of education and prevention services, including Suicide Prevention Services, for schools, civic organizations, faith-based institutions and private businesses.

North Central operates the largest 988 Suicide & Crisis Call Center in Ohio.
